Laurie Torres crafts a sound that feels like a private conversation between a piano and the room it inhabits. Her music is characterized by a delicate, felted piano touch where you can often hear the mechanical whisper of the instrument itself. It is not just about the notes, but the space between them, creating a breathable atmosphere that sits comfortably between modern classical and ambient jazz.
What sets her apart is her background as a multi-instrumentalist. She brings a drummer's sense of timing and a post-rocker's appreciation for texture to the piano. The result is music that feels rhythmic and structured yet remains incredibly soft and unobtrusive. It avoids the sentimentality of typical 'relaxing piano' music by maintaining a sophisticated, slightly mysterious harmonic edge.
Start with her 2025 album 'Après coup' to experience her most refined work. It is the perfect companion for anyone who needs to lower the temperature of their environment or find a steady, calm rhythm for creative work. It is music that doesn't demand your attention but rewards it deeply if you choose to lean in.
